Output 5d261c01e8e95c24cfb8764bf29a5bf811fd6747cca2ceda1ac8d2549defa787:1

value
39000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d828e43f2800f146653220e7f5891abc1207289 OP_EQUAL
address
3MtFf7H2UK7h1eJmzRkjb9Sja4kiQEzwyP
transaction
5d261c01e8e95c24cfb8764bf29a5bf811fd6747cca2ceda1ac8d2549defa787
spent
true